1. Adequate sunlightThe growth and maintenance of snapdragon cannot be separated from sunlight. It is best to place it in a place with good lighting outdoors. If you grow it at home, you can place it on the balcony. This location has sufficient light and is very suitable for growth. You can give it full light during the time when the light is not strong. However, please note that although it likes light, it cannot tolerate high temperatures. It needs shade in the summer to lower the temperature and cannot be exposed to the scorching sun. Also, be careful not to expose it to strong light immediately after sowing and planting. It should be allowed to grow slowly before being placed on the balcony. 2. Temperature requirementsIt likes to grow in a cool environment and grows well within the range of 15-18℃, which can promote better growth. When the temperature is very high in summer, in addition to providing shade to avoid prolonged exposure to the sun, you also need to spray water around to lower the temperature during growth through evaporation. 3. Apply moistureIt has a high demand for water, and reasonable application of water is required to ensure its growth needs. Although it requires a lot of water, do not give it too much water to avoid water accumulation. 4. Apply fertilizerDuring the rapid growth stage, fertilizer should be applied every 10-15 days. The concentration should be lighter and concentrated fertilizer should not be applied. |
